PS work:
-selective colors to boost blue
-increased saturation and decreased brightness a bit
-rotate 1° counterclockwise
-some cropping
-resize
-added white border 2pixel
-flipped left-right

I'm not happy about the upper right corner but didn't shot from better angle... so this one will have to do. I hope someone likes it. :)

Greetings from the Critique Club
by strangeghost

COMPOSITION
Certainly meets the challenge by showing an unusual building from an interesting perspective. The composition is filled with lines, more lines, still more lines; all forming interesting angles and a treat for the eye to wander around. The single open window near the bottom left adds further interest. It may be been interesting to move this mini focal point to a third and re-compose from there, possibly eliminating the distraction you noted at the upper right. I may also have considered just using the left surface of the building, which has far fewer reflective inconsistencies.

TECHNIQUE
I can't find any fault with the technique at all. Everything is sharp throughout, colors are striking, though mostly a blend of blue tones. Nice job capturing an interesting gradient in the sky too. The area around the hidden sun is subtle. Just perfect, IMO.

OVERALL IMPACT
This is a very nice picture with a lot of instant visual appeal. I'm a little surprised that it finished at 5.8. While a respectable score, I imagine you were a little disappointed that it was not higher. I can't see what part of the football stadium this is. Very interesting choice in subject and excellent job on all fronts.
